JIS G3311 Grade S60CM annealed general

Property Temperature Value Comment
Density 23.0 °C Density of 7.8 - 7.9 g/cm³ Typical for High Carbon Steel

JIS G3311 Grade S60CM annealed thermal

Property Temperature Value Comment
Coefficient of thermal expansion 23.0 °C Coefficient of thermal expansion of 1.32E-5 1/K Typical for High Carbon Steel
Max service temperature - Max service temperature of 500 °C Typical for Carbon Steel
Melting point - Melting point of 1289 - 1478 °C Typical for High Carbon Steel
Specific heat capacity 23.0 °C Specific heat capacity of 486 J/(kg·K) Typical for High Carbon Steel
Thermal conductivity 23.0 °C Thermal conductivity of 36 W/(m·K) Typical for High Carbon Steel

JIS G3311 Grade S60CM annealed electrical

Property Temperature Value Comment
Electrical resistivity 23.0 °C Electrical resistivity of 1.43E-7 - 1.74E-7 Ω·m Typical for Carbon Steel

JIS G3311 Grade S60CM annealed mechanical

Property Temperature Value Comment
Elastic modulus 23.0 °C Elastic modulus of 200 - 215 GPa Typical for High Carbon Steel
Hardness, Vickers 23.0 °C Hardness, Vickers of 190 [-] -
Poisson's ratio 23.0 °C Poisson's ratio of 0.29 [-] Typical for High Carbon Steel
Shear modulus 23.0 °C Shear modulus of 81 GPa Typical for High Carbon Steel
